Fill in the blank with an appropriate preposition phrase.
The crew were _______ the ship for a month.

  1. A
    on board
  2. B
    aboard
  3. C
    on
  4. D
    off

Solution & Step-by-step Explanation

While 'aboard' or 'on board' are close options, 'aboard' functions directly as a preposition meaning on or onto a ship or aircraft (e.g., "aboard the ship").
